The Rise of Home-Based Businesses

 

Home-based businesses have experienced tremendous growth over the last several years. Thanks to advances in technology, affordable digital tools, and changing work habits, entrepreneurs can now launch successful businesses without renting office space or investing significant capital. Whether it’s an online retail store, digital marketing agency, consulting firm, or freelance service, operating from home has become a practical and profitable option for millions of people.

As remote work continues to reshape the business landscape, home-based businesses are becoming an essential part of the modern economy. Entrepreneurs enjoy greater flexibility, lower operating costs, and the freedom to build a business around their personal lifestyle.

Why Home-Based Businesses Are Growing

Several factors have contributed to the rapid increase in home-based entrepreneurship.

 

Low Startup Costs

One of the biggest advantages of starting a home-based business is affordability. Traditional businesses often require office leases, utilities, furniture, and equipment. Home-based entrepreneurs eliminate many of these expenses, allowing them to invest more in marketing, technology, and customer service.

 

Technology Makes Business Easier

Cloud computing, video conferencing, project management software, online payment systems, and e-commerce platforms have made it possible to operate a business entirely online. Business owners can communicate with clients, process payments, manage inventory, and market their services from virtually anywhere.

 

Flexible Work Schedule

Home-based businesses allow owners to create schedules that fit their personal lives. Parents, caregivers, retirees, students, and professionals seeking additional income all benefit from flexible working hours.

 

Access to Global Customers

Instead of relying on local foot traffic, online businesses can reach customers worldwide through websites, social media, search engines, and online marketplaces. This expanded reach creates new opportunities for growth and revenue.

Benefits of Running a Home-Based Business

 

Lower Business Expenses

Working from home significantly reduces rent, commuting, utilities, and office maintenance costs. Lower expenses often translate into higher profit margins.

 

Better Work-Life Balance

Entrepreneurs gain more control over their daily routines, allowing them to spend more time with family while pursuing business goals.

 

Tax Advantages

Depending on local tax laws and business structure, home-based business owners may qualify for deductions related to home office expenses, internet service, business equipment, and utilities. Consulting a qualified tax professional is recommended.

 

Increased Productivity

Many entrepreneurs report fewer workplace distractions and greater focus when working from a dedicated home office.

 

Challenges Home-Based Business Owners Face

Although there are many benefits, home-based businesses also present challenges.

 

Staying Motivated

Without a structured office environment, maintaining productivity requires discipline and effective time management.

 

Separating Work From Personal Life

Creating a dedicated workspace helps establish boundaries between professional and personal responsibilities.

 

Building Brand Credibility

New businesses must establish trust through professional branding, customer reviews, quality websites, and exceptional customer service.

 

Managing Growth

As demand increases, entrepreneurs may need to outsource tasks, hire employees, or invest in automation to maintain efficiency.

The Future of Home-Based Businesses

The future looks exceptionally bright for home-based entrepreneurs. Advances in artificial intelligence, automation, cloud technology, and digital communication continue to lower barriers to entry. Consumers are increasingly comfortable purchasing products and services online, creating even more opportunities for small business owners.

As remote work and digital commerce become standard across industries, home-based businesses are expected to remain one of the fastest-growing segments of entrepreneurship.
